RE: Reminder - to avoid disapointment
RPI is not really our priority right now. WINNING is #1 on our priority list. Like it or not, losing for a non-BCS team is "verboten" if you want to comfortably exist in the "Power Conference" dominated environment as we approach March Madness. Listening to the "talking experts" on ESPN's College Basketball Show was to hear all the possible reasons why the "PC" members should have greater leeway in poor records since they play a "more demanding schedule" i.e.other conference members. It is just like in football, the BCS teams play in BCS Bowls with one, even two losses, but non-BCS teams must have perfect undefeated records to even get to play at all (then they get placed in a "sidecar bowl" where they can only beat each other).
